Transaction 5d35f379bf7f1e324109bd1b78249978e976b7fdb7f78a2911640f567052a103
2 Input
2 Outputs
- 5d35f379bf7f1e324109bd1b78249978e976b7fdb7f78a2911640f567052a103:0
- 5d35f379bf7f1e324109bd1b78249978e976b7fdb7f78a2911640f567052a103:1
value 20956352
address 124YkM77CQ8owDGBuf6jw3f3mgLdJLHKnc
value 54688440
address 1GwVwP36eqS8rVjNxL28DsAPthoP5HkT9M